Reframing the Thoughts That Steal Joy

from Intentional Musicianship · host Jeff Price

In this episode of Intentional Musicianship, Jeff Price Jeff Price explores what happens after a performance, when the music has ended, the applause has faded, and the internal conversation begins. Drawing from a recent studio recital experience, Jeff reflects on how joy can slip away, not because the performance failed, but because of the thoughts that quietly surface afterward. Comparison, imagined judgment, and premature self-evaluation often replace the confidence, poise, and generosity that were present while sharing the music. This episode examines the mindset shift that occurs once we leave the stage and why timing matters when it comes to reflection and growth. Jeff discusses the difference between healthy evaluation and self-talk that undermines joy, why audiences experience performances differently than performers do, and how receiving gratitude is part of professional maturity. Rather than offering formulas or prescriptions, this conversation invites performers and educators to reframe post-performance thinking, honoring the act of sharing first and then preparing intentionally for what comes next.
